- What is KBR's current debt?
- KBR (KBR) reported current debt of $49M in Q1 2026.
- How has KBR's current debt changed year-over-year?
- KBR's current debt increased by 25.6% year-over-year, from $39M to $49M.
- What is the long-term trend for KBR's current debt?
- Over 5 years (2020 to 2025), KBR's current debt has grown at a 32.5%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$12M to $49M.
- What does current debt mean?
- The portion of long-term debt maturing within the next 12 months, requiring refinancing or repayment from operating cash flows.
